The first U.S. Air Force F-15 Eagle arrives at Kingsley Field in Klamath Falls, Ore., in 1998 from the 159th Fighter Wing in Louisiana. The two-seat, B-model was integral to beginning a new era of fighter training in the Eagle at the wing, which continues today 24 years later.
